Are you a strategic, hands-on leader with a passion for civil engineering and land development?

CAGE Engineering is looking for an experienced Project Manager - Land Development to oversee dynamic, high-impact projects in the Charlotte, NC area.

In this key role, you’ll manage all aspects of land development projects—from scope and financials to team leadership and client relationships.

You’ll also play an essential role in mentoring staff, aligning team strengths with project needs, and delivering efficient, high-quality results that reflect the CAGE brand.

Whether you’re a seasoned project engineer ready for the next step, or a current PM looking to make a broader impact, this role offers an opportunity to lead with purpose and shape the future of land development in a growing market.

What You’ll Do Lead and manage civil engineering project teams, ensuring high performance in design production, internal coordination, and client satisfaction.

Own project scope, schedules, and budgets while delivering profitable results.

Mentor and develop team members by identifying strengths and removing roadblocks to success.

Collaborate with clients to build long-term relationships and ensure repeat business.

Prepare proposals, negotiate contracts, and clearly define deliverables.

Reinforce CAGE’s brand promises through consistent, high-quality project delivery. What You Bring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ering or related field 7+ years of experience in civil land development PE license preferred (but not required) Proven success as a project engineer or project manager with strong technical skills Ability to delegate tasks effectively and manage teams independently Strong communication, critical thinking, and problem-solving skills Track record of managing profitable projects and satisfied clients Why CAGE?
